Mod «Plysken Solar Revolution» for Project Zomboid
Plysken Solar Revolution for Project Zomboid.
This mod adds a complete off-grid solar energy system to Project Zomboid Build 42+, compatible with singleplayer, co-op (host), and dedicated servers. Harness the power of the sun to keep your base running long after the grid goes dark. The system includes solar panels, battery banks, and a failsafe backup generator relay. How It Works
Place a Power Bank inside your base and connect solar panels to it. The bank charges during the day and powers any nearby vanilla appliances—lights, fridges, freezers, TVs—exactly like a generator, but without the noise or fuel consumption. At night, or when clouds roll in, stored energy keeps everything running. When the bank runs dry, an optional Solar Failsafe can automatically kick in your vanilla generator. As of v1.1, the Power Bank powers the entire building it is in, and multiple banks can be linked together into a shared network.
Items
- Solar Panels
- Solar Panel (Flat) — Placed flat on the ground or a roof for maximum sun exposure.
- Solar Panel (Wall) — Mounted on a wall (North or West facing). Requires a wall surface.
- Solar Panel (Mounted) — Angled floor stand for flexible outdoor placement.
- Solar Panel — Raw component used to craft the three panel types above.
- Power Storage
- Power Bank — The heart of your solar system. Stores energy, powers the entire building it is in, and accepts PSR batteries. Crafted with an inverter, metal, and electronic components. Can be linked to adjacent banks to form a shared network.
- 200Ah Battery — High-capacity battery for the bank. Found as loot.
- 400Ah Battery — Maximum capacity battery. Rare loot.
- Wired Car Battery — Any car battery rewired for the bank. Capacity and quality depend on your Electricity skill.
- Improvised Battery — Crafted from scrap metal and salvaged parts. A renewable alternative to car batteries.
- DIY Battery — Built from multiple wired car batteries or improvised batteries combined into one higher-capacity unit.
- Electronics
- Inverter — Required component to build the Power Bank.
- Solar Failsafe — Connects to a vanilla generator. Starts automatically (1 game tick) when the bank cannot keep up with demand and stops automatically (1 game tick) when the bank recovers.
- Literature
- New Advancements: Energy From The Sun — Skill magazine. Teaches all PSR recipes. Find it in the world or in loot crates.
Sandbox Options
Fine-tune the mod to your playstyle:
- Solar panel efficiency (1–100%)
- Charge frequency (every 10 minutes or every hour)
- Battery degradation severity
- DIY battery capacity multiplier
- Loot rarity multipliers (panels, batteries, misc)
- Battery Bank world spawn rarity
- Panel connection time
- Enable advanced crafting recipes (solar panel and inverter from scratch)
World Spawns
Solar loot crates and pre-built battery banks can spawn in garages, storage units, and farm buildings.
